FRYER ROOFING CO., INC., a California Corporation; DAVID BRUCE FRYER; LEIGH ANN FRYER; INTERNATIONAL FIDELITY INSURANCE COMPANY; and DOES 1 through 50, inclusive, Defendants. 19 20 21 On October 31, 2013, Plaintiffs filed a motion for judgment pursuant to a written 22 settlement agreement entered on December 6, 2012, and amended on June 20, 2013. Doc. 35, 2:7- 23 8. Plaintiffs’ motion alleged that Defendants had become delinquent on the payment schedule, and 24 requested the Court to enter a judgment for the outstanding settlement balance. Doc. 35, 2:14-18. 25 Defendants did not oppose the motion, but requested the Court to inquire of amounts due prior to 26 entering judgment to account for payments made in the interim. Doc. 37. The Court directed the 27 parties to file a joint proposed order listing the remaining outstanding accounts. Doc. 38. On 28 December 3, 2013, the parties filed a joint statement indicating the remaining amount. Doc. 39. 1 On March 7, 2014, the parties filed a supplemental joint statement, which reduced the 2 amount by the amount of a bond disbursement by Defendant International Fidelity Insurance 3 Company (“IFIC”) on behalf of Defendant Fryer Roofing Co., Inc. Doc. 40, 2:10-13. Plaintiff’s 4 claims against IFIC have been fully resolved. Doc. 40, 2:18-20. The parties jointly request that an 5 order be issued for the settlement balance of thirteen thousand six hundred thirty dollars and 6 ninety cents ($13,630.90).1 Doc. 40, 2:13-15. 7 ORDER 8 In accordance with the joint statement and request of the parties, JUDGMENT IS 9 HEREBY ENTERED against Defendants Fryer Roofing Co., Inc., David Bruce Fryer, and Leigh 10 Ann Fryer, jointly and severally, in the amount of thirteen thousand six hundred thirty dollars and 11 ninety cents ($13,630.90). 12 13 14 IT IS SO ORDERED. Dated: August 6, 2014 SENIOR DISTRICT JUDGE 15 16 17 18 19 20 21 22 23 24 25 26 27 28 1 Several months have lapsed since the filing of the joint statement. Should the parties require an amendment to the amount specified by this order, they shall submit a supplemental joint statement and proposed order for the updated amount. 2
